I ran into following exception. The task was creating thumbnail images and passing them to the client via web services. GetThumbnail method of Image class error out

System.Web.Services.Protocols.SoapException: System.NullReferenceException: Object reference not set to an instance of an object
at System.Drawing.SafeNativeMethods.GdipCreateBitmapFromScan0(Int32 width, Int32 height, Int32 stride, Int32 format, HandleRef scan0, IntPtr& bitmap
at System.Drawing.Bitmap..ctor(Int32 width, Int32 height, PixelFormat format
at System.Drawing.Bitmap..ctor(Int32 width, Int32 height
at Code.DataAccess.CatalogEditing.Imaging.ImageAccess.GetImage(Int32 ImageID

We could only fixed the problem by UNINSTALLING and INSTALLING the .Net Framework in the production box

Does anyone has an idea about why it did happen
